Royal Wedding Procession
9 {King Solomon} made for himself a sedan chair from the wood of Lebanon. 10 He made its column of silver, its back of gold, its seat of purple; its interior is inlaid [with] leather by {the maidens of Jerusalem}. 11 Come out and look, {O maidens of Zion}, at {King Solomon}, at the crown with which his mother crowned him on the day of his wedding, on the day of the joy of his heart!
